The Keystone device, previously known in the past as Cobo Wallet, is a hardware wallet that is growing in popularity with institutions and individuals seeking secure methods to store their cryptocurrency. It was founded on the 17th of January 2017 by Discus Fish and Changhao Jiang, Keystone offers a range of products that are focused on security along with reliability and comfort for its clients.

One of the main characteristics of this Keystone device is its air-gapped capability meaning that it doesn’t need be connected to any online device. This additional layer of security ensures that the money is protected from online threats like hacking or fraud. The device is also open-source, which means that the code is made available for review and scrutiny which further enhances the security of the device. Furthermore, the device can support multiple cryptocurrencies, including Bitcoin, Bitcoin Cash, Dash, Ethereum, EOS, Litecoin, Polkadot, Tether, and Tron along with a number of ETH, TRON, and EOS digital tokens.

The setup process for keystone Keystone device is easy. First, the device is turned on, and then the QR code is scan with the device’s camera via the Keystone website to authenticate the device. After that, a password will be established and the conditions of service are agreed to. Following this, the 24-word seed phrase is written down on the seed phrase book or an undigital medium. This seed phrase is crucial to the security of the device, therefore it is crucial that it is kept protected and never used to take a picture or typed onto smartphone or computer.

The device is connected to the Keystone application, which is available on the Apple App store or Google Play store. This app acts as an interface for approving and verify transactions, however it is vital to keep in mind that the device itself is not connected to the internet. This additional layer of security guarantees that your funds are secure even if the smartphone is compromised.
